I found that the entire /sys/conf/files section for the 'urtwn' USB network
device was completely missing on my FreeBSD 11 installation. I copied that
section from my FreeBSD 10 Release computer and changed the directories to
match the new file location. My kernel compiles with the 'urtwn' and
'urtwnfw' devices but ifconfig still doesn't start my USB network device.
The DMESG shows the correct model number of the EDIMAX N150 device but
ifconfig still thinks that this device is not present. I also tried a Belkin
device that uses the same Realtek 8188US chip with the same results. I added
the license ack to /boot/loader.conf as well.
It looks like there is still some work required to make this device operate
with FreeBSD 11.
